Saha is a name often given to girls. Ranked #17315 and holds a steady place on the charts. It comes from a Sanskrit (Indian) origin and traditionally means "With tolerance and companionship in life". It has 2 syllables.
Saha draws from Sanskrit roots implying endurance and togetherness. In modern usage it remains rare yet elegant, often chosen by parents seeking a soft, cross-cultural sound. Girls named Saha tend to be seen as calm mediators with a steady, nurturing presence.
